0%

下几个软件搞搞正事

在我的新电脑(半年了没干什么正事)上下点要用的软件

LaTeX

先下一个 LaTeX
即下一个 TeX 排版引擎,TeX 的发行版有 Tex Live 和 MiKTeX
这里下 TeX Live,还要为 LaTeX 选一款编辑器,这里决定把 VSCode 的环境配置一下,并且下一个 TeXstudio 集成环境【这是 TeXstudio 的介绍】

一个非常快速的 Latex 入门教程
这个视频中提到了 TeX Live 的下载地址LaTeX 公式编辑器 与一份【一份(不太)简短的 LaTeX 介绍】,这份文档打印出来很久了,一直没怎么看,现在用上了

打开这个网站 TeX Live 的下载地址
点 installing TeX Live over the Internet 把安装包 install-tl-windows.exe 下下来

安装时间较长。。。

接着对 VSCode 进行快速的 LaTeX 环境配置
下载一个名为 LaTeX Workshop 的插件

然后导入配置
点左下齿轮,点设置,点右上的打开设置(json),这样就打开了设置文件

我的初始配置文件内容:

1
2
3
4
5
6
7
8
9
{
"emmet.variables": {
"lang": "zh-CN"
},
"workbench.settings.applyToAllProfiles": [
"editor.tabSize"
],
"editor.detectIndentation": false
}

初始应该是空{ },不知到啥时候变这样的,先保留一下
顺便问一下 ChatGPT:

好的,你提供的JSON代码看起来与Visual Studio Code(VS Code)相关。以下是你提供的设置的解释:
“emmet.variables”: 这个设置与Emmet相关,Emmet是一个用于加速编写HTML和CSS代码的工具包。在这里,你设置了一个名为 lang 的变量,其值为 “zh-CN”,这很可能表示了Emmet的语言或区域设置为简体中文。
“workbench.settings.applyToAllProfiles”: 这个设置指示指定的设置将应用于所有用户配置文件。在这里,它被设置为应用于设置 “editor.tabSize”。
“editor.tabSize”: 这个设置定义了在代码编辑器中表示单级缩进所使用的空格数。它影响在按下Tab键时代码的格式。
“editor.detectIndentation”: 这个设置控制编辑器是否应该根据文件内容自动检测缩进设置。在这里,它被设置为 false,这意味着编辑器不会尝试自动检测缩进。

将其替换为:【这里参考的是 使用 Vscode 配置 LaTeX

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
{
"latex-workshop.latex.autoBuild.run": "never",
"latex-workshop.showContextMenu": true,
"latex-workshop.intellisense.package.enabled": true,
"latex-workshop.message.error.show": false,
"latex-workshop.message.warning.show": false,
"latex-workshop.latex.tools": [
{
"name": "xelatex",
"command": "xelatex",
"args": [
"-synctex=1",
"-interaction=nonstopmode",
"-file-line-error",
"%DOCFILE%"
]
},
{
"name": "pdflatex",
"command": "pdflatex",
"args": [
"-synctex=1",
"-interaction=nonstopmode",
"-file-line-error",
"%DOCFILE%"
]
},
{
"name": "latexmk",
"command": "latexmk",
"args": [
"-synctex=1",
"-interaction=nonstopmode",
"-file-line-error",
"-pdf",
"-outdir=%OUTDIR%",
"%DOCFILE%"
]
},
{
"name": "bibtex",
"command": "bibtex",
"args": [
"%DOCFILE%"
]
}
],
"latex-workshop.latex.recipes": [
{
"name": "XeLaTeX",
"tools": [
"xelatex"
]
},
{
"name": "PDFLaTeX",
"tools": [
"pdflatex"
]
},
{
"name": "BibTeX",
"tools": [
"bibtex"
]
},
{
"name": "LaTeXmk",
"tools": [
"latexmk"
]
},
{
"name": "xelatex -> bibtex -> xelatex*2",
"tools": [
"xelatex",
"bibtex",
"xelatex",
"xelatex"
]
},
{
"name": "pdflatex -> bibtex -> pdflatex*2",
"tools": [
"pdflatex",
"bibtex",
"pdflatex",
"pdflatex"
]
},
],
"latex-workshop.latex.clean.fileTypes": [
"*.aux",
"*.bbl",
"*.blg",
"*.idx",
"*.ind",
"*.lof",
"*.lot",
"*.out",
"*.toc",
"*.acn",
"*.acr",
"*.alg",
"*.glg",
"*.glo",
"*.gls",
"*.ist",
"*.fls",
"*.log",
"*.fdb_latexmk"
],
"latex-workshop.latex.autoClean.run": "onFailed",
"latex-workshop.latex.recipe.default": "lastUsed",
"latex-workshop.view.pdf.internal.synctex.keybinding": "double-click",
}

完了以后,用一个 LaTeX 文件测试一下

1
2
3
4
\documentclass{ctexart}
\begin{document}
“你好,世界!” 来自 \LaTeX{} 的问候。
\end{document}

VSCode 的右上角:
Build LaTeX project(绿色箭头按键,快捷键 Ctrl + Alt + B)
View LaTeX PDF file(放大镜按键,快捷键 Ctrl + Alt + V)

接着是下 TeXstudio
TeXstudio 的官网,直接点下载
这里下的是 texstudio-4.6.3-win-qt6.exe,直接安装
这里下完就直接是默认的中文了,不用按教程再改成中文
注:在 Options > Configure TeXstudio 的 General 里面设置 Language 为 zh_CN (Chinese)

OK,LaTeX 的部分完了,之后再看看文献管理工具 Zotero 是个什么情况

CAJViewer

下一个 CAJ 阅读器,看知网论文用
访问 cajviewer 浏览器官网,直接下载

知云

下一个知云,翻译英文文献用
访问 知云文献翻译官网,直接下载
两个翻译引擎也够用

Visio

Visio 用来画图,论文、博文、笔记啥的图都可以,配合 PPT 使用,两个在画图上都不错
在微信公众号软件管家里弄到百度网盘的压缩包
office 和 visio 要共存,需要相同位数的安装包,这里我的 office 都是 64 bit 的
所以 visio 也下 64 bit 的
按照公众号的教程来,visio 21 就装好了,注意电脑里的 windows defender

Matlab

Matlab 最近的机械优化设计课上又要用了,赶紧下一下
还是在微信公众号软件管家里弄到百度网盘的压缩包,之后的软件都在这里面弄了
(因为都下不了正版,只能下盗版、破解版)
版本为 MatlabR2023b
重要的是它给的安装密钥与许可证文件 licese.lic,最后再找到安装路径将 win64 文件进行替换

Altium Designer

AD23 用来画板子,目前还啥都不会

Multisim、 Proteus 和 Keil

这哥仨还不急

SolidWorks

这个比较重量级,机械学生总要会一样机械的工程软件吧
安装起来比较麻烦,一步步来就好

Zotero

Zotero 官网
Zotero 6 for Windows 与 Zotero Connector 这两个东西都要下下来
其中 Zotero Connector 是 Chrome 浏览器的插件,方便在 Chrome 上浏览论文的时候加入自己的文献库
为了在写 LaTeX 的时候结合 Zotero,需要下一个叫 Better-BibTeX 的插件,并安装在 Zotero 上
下载地址在 github 的 zotero-better-bibtex 开源仓库
下它最新的发行版就行,这里下载的是 zotero-better-bibtex-6.7.136.xpi
为了能够配合 VSCode 使用,在 VSCode 中安装扩展 Zotero LaTeX
安装后将设置中的 Zotero: LaTeX Command 一项改为 cite